How the scores fell
This is how 1,002 scans spread across the five score bands in August 2026. A large group clears the top band while a real tail is left behind, so the median understates how well the leading pages do.

| Score band | LLM Readability |
|---|---|
| 0–19 | 0% · 0 |
| 20–39 | 3% · 28 |
| 40–59 | 25% · 251 |
| 60–79 | 27% · 269 |
| 80–100 | 45% · 454 |
| Total runs | 1,002 |
Where sites got stuck
The checks that did not pass in LLM Readability Score scans during August 2026. What each check means and what to do about it is on the tool's own benchmark page; this page is the record of the month.
| Check | Did not pass | Weight |
|---|---|---|
| Has a summary / TL;DR | 94% | Partial |
| No very long sentences (>40 words) | 70% | Hard fail |
| Ideal average sentence length | 35% | Hard fail |
| Few long sentences (>28 words) | 33% | Partial |
| Uses lists | 19% | Partial |
| Broken into paragraphs | 10% | Partial |
| Reasonable average word length | 9% | Partial |
| Healthy lexical variety | 9% | Partial |
| Self-contained short passages | 7% | Partial |
| Varied sentence rhythm | 6% | Partial |
| Low share of long/complex words | 1% | Partial |

This month’s sample
In August 2026 the LLM Readability Score recorded 1,002 successful scans across 876 unique domains. Across the whole series that month there were 34,236 scans covering 5,586 sites.

What was the median LLM Readability Score score in August 2026?
In August 2026 the median was 75/100 and the mean was 73.2. 45% of scans reached 80 or above. These figures are frozen and will not change.
Which check failed most often in August 2026?
“Has a summary / TL;DR”, which did not pass in 94% of scans, followed by “No very long sentences (>40 words)” at 70%.
